Internationally acclaimed actor Adil Hussain has added another feather to his cap. The versatile actor has made it to the Forbes list of ‘Best Performances of 2020’ for his stellar performance in the movie ‘Pareeksha’ directed by Prakash Jha.

Hussain earned the recognition for his brilliant acting in the film for his character of ‘Bucchi Paswan’.

Based on a real-life story, Pareeksha is about a rickshaw puller in Bihar whose desire to get his son enrolled in the city’s best English-medium private school, surmounts all else.

The Life of Pi actor took to his Twitter account to share the news with his fans.

Earlier, Adil Hussain starrer “Delhi Crime” also bagged the award for Best Drama Series at the 48th International Emmy Awards this year.

Some other actors who made it to the list are Pankaj Tripathi, Nawazuddin Siddiqui, Tripti Dimri, Vikrant Massey, Vijay Varma, Manoj Bajpayee along with Jaydeep Ahlawat, Kriti Kulhari and Pratik Gandhi.
